No one will stop me from doing my job, is the message of the Mayor of Athens, Costas Bakoyannis, after the incident of gathering members of Rubicon outside a cafeteria where there was an event where he was.

As it is emphasized in a relevant announcement, the Mayor, every day visits a different neighborhood of Athens.

Tonight he was in Kato Patisia, and while talking, in a cafe in the area, with citizens about neighborhood issues, a group of members of the Rubicon appeared holding banners, throwing T-shirts and shouting slogans.

The Mayor, as stated in the announcement, unaffected and with absolute composure, continued to listen and answer the questions of those present. He continued to do his job as he usually says.

The intervention of the police led to arrests.

Costas Bakoyannis asked not to be persecuted, but made a harsh post on social networks.

“No hafiedotsourmo overshadows me and can not stop me from doing my job. “Every day, in a different neighborhood, I talk to Athenians,” he wrote specifically.
